Output 98e63284c61023d934d71659cdb6aeb8eeda37a5f3a2709784a982f163ffa9a2:2

value
24500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ffe8bb65683fa69157509b24f2ea6be3abe6852f OP_EQUAL
address
AFmPmoxes9ZSfLf8js2u6wfqv82Mu53uhw
transaction
98e63284c61023d934d71659cdb6aeb8eeda37a5f3a2709784a982f163ffa9a2